Apr 18, 2023 · According to research in the Economist’s 1843 magazine, the average person is awake between 16.5 and 17.5 hours per day (excluding sleep). Yet when it comes to screen time, our research shows that the world uses around 40% of their day — 6 hrs 37 mins to be precise, on a computer or mobile device. To set up Screen Time, from the home screen select the Settings app. 2. Select Screen Time. Review the Screen Time prompt, then select Turn On Screen Time. 3. Review the "Is This iPhone for Yourself or Your Child?" prompt, then select the desired option. Note: For this demonstration, This is My iPhone was selected.Respond to requests for more screen time from family members. See Change Requests settings in Screen Time. Share across devices. Include time spent on other devices where you’re signed in with the same Apple ID in the Screen Time reports. You need to turn on this option on each device you want to include in the Screen Time reports.
